Transaction 768764d5ce9473904daf2b5069fa00a160a98718ca030da91d4b076224ec7579
1 Input
1 Output
-
768764d5ce9473904daf2b5069fa00a160a98718ca030da91d4b076224ec7579:0
- value
- 552450
- script pubkey
- OP_0 OP_PUSHBYTES_20 a762d90deaa123b438058bf4e3be4b019a453f5e
- address
- bc1q5a3djr025y3mgwq9306w80jtqxdy20677lg2pf